Tips Regarding Ammunition Management for Zombie Hunter-Themed Airsoft Guns
Effective management of ammunition is crucial for optimal performance when utilizing magazines stylized with a “zombie hunter” theme. These tips address practical considerations for maximizing efficiency and maintaining readiness in simulated combat scenarios.
Tip 1: Pre-Load Magazines Before Gameplay: Prior to engaging in airsoft activities, ensure all magazines are fully loaded. This eliminates the need for on-the-field reloading, preserving a tactical advantage during critical moments. A speed loader is recommended for efficiency.
Tip 2: Utilize a Magazine Carrier System: Employ a tactical vest or belt equipped with magazine pouches. This facilitates rapid access to spare magazines and streamlines the reloading process, minimizing downtime.
Tip 3: Maintain Magazine Cleanliness: Regularly inspect and clean magazines to remove debris that may impede BB feeding. Compressed air and a soft cloth are suitable for this purpose. Consistent maintenance prevents malfunctions.
Tip 4: Employ Correct BB Weight and Type: Utilize BBs specifically designed for airsoft guns, ensuring compatibility with the magazine and the airsoft gun’s hop-up system. Improper BB weight can negatively impact range and accuracy.
Tip 5: Practice Reloading Drills: Conduct repetitive practice drills to develop muscle memory and proficiency in reloading magazines. Speed and efficiency in reloading are vital for maintaining a sustained rate of fire.
Tip 6: Protect Magazines from Environmental Exposure: Shield magazines from extreme temperatures and moisture to prevent damage or deformation. Prolonged exposure to these elements can degrade plastic components and affect functionality.
Tip 7: Cycle Magazines Regularly: To evenly distribute wear, rotate the usage of multiple magazines during gameplay. This extends the overall lifespan of each magazine and reduces the likelihood of malfunction.

1. Capacity
Capacity, in the context of “zombie hunter airsoft gun magazines,” is a critical factor determining the sustained firepower available to the airsoft player. It directly influences the duration of engagement before requiring a reload, a particularly important consideration in scenarios simulating prolonged combat or overwhelming opposition.
- Standard vs. High-Capacity Magazines
Standard capacity magazines typically hold a realistic number of BBs, often mirroring the capacity of real firearms. High-capacity magazines, sometimes referred to as “hi-caps,” can hold hundreds of BBs, providing a significant advantage in sustained fire. The choice between standard and high-capacity depends on the player’s preferred style of play and the rules of the specific airsoft event.
- Impact on Gameplay Tactics
Magazine capacity shapes tactical decisions. Players with high-capacity magazines can maintain suppressive fire for extended periods, potentially overwhelming opponents. Conversely, players with standard-capacity magazines must prioritize accuracy and ammunition conservation, promoting a more deliberate and strategic approach. Scenarios favoring rapid advancement and sustained aggression often benefit from higher capacity.
- Relationship to Realism
Standard-capacity magazines often appeal to players seeking a more realistic simulation experience. Limiting ammunition capacity necessitates careful resource management and tactical planning, mirroring the challenges faced in real-world combat scenarios. High-capacity magazines, while offering a tactical advantage, deviate from strict realism.
- Winding Mechanisms and Reliability
High-capacity magazines frequently employ a winding mechanism to feed BBs into the airsoft gun. The reliability of this mechanism is crucial. Poorly designed or maintained winding systems can lead to feeding failures, negating the advantage of increased capacity. Proper winding and regular maintenance are essential for optimal performance.

3. Construction
The construction of “zombie hunter airsoft gun magazines” significantly influences their durability, reliability, and overall performance. Material selection, assembly methods, and design features contribute to the magazine’s ability to withstand the rigors of airsoft gameplay and consistently feed BBs into the airsoft gun. Improper construction can lead to premature failure, feeding malfunctions, and a diminished airsoft experience.
- Material Composition
The materials used in magazine construction, typically polymers or metals, dictate their resistance to impact, abrasion, and environmental factors. Polymer magazines offer lightweight durability and resistance to corrosion, while metal magazines provide enhanced rigidity and a more realistic aesthetic. The quality of the chosen material directly impacts the magazine’s lifespan and its ability to withstand repeated use and potential impacts during gameplay. For example, a high-grade polymer, such as reinforced nylon, will provide greater resistance to cracking and deformation compared to a cheaper, less durable plastic.
- Internal Components
The internal components, including the spring, follower, and BB retention mechanism, are critical for reliable BB feeding. The spring must maintain consistent tension to ensure proper BB advancement, while the follower guides the BBs smoothly into the feeding chamber. The retention mechanism prevents BBs from spilling out of the magazine. The quality and design of these components directly affect the magazine’s ability to consistently feed BBs without jams or misfeeds. A well-designed follower, for instance, minimizes friction and ensures smooth BB movement.
- Assembly and Manufacturing Tolerances
Precise assembly and tight manufacturing tolerances are essential for proper magazine function. Gaps or misalignment between components can lead to BBs jamming or failing to feed correctly. Consistent manufacturing processes ensure that each magazine meets the required specifications for compatibility and reliable performance. Tight tolerances between the magazine body and the airsoft gun’s magazine well are also crucial for a secure fit and proper feeding alignment. Variations in manufacturing quality can result in significant differences in magazine performance.
- Reinforcement and Structural Integrity
Reinforcement features, such as metal inserts or reinforced polymer sections, can enhance the magazine’s structural integrity and resistance to damage. These features are particularly important for high-capacity magazines, which are subject to greater stress due to the increased BB load. Reinforcement in critical areas, such as the magazine lips or the baseplate, helps to prevent cracking or deformation during use. A well-reinforced magazine is more likely to withstand the demands of intense airsoft gameplay.

4. Feeding Reliability
Feeding reliability, in the context of “zombie hunter airsoft gun magazine,” denotes the magazine’s consistent ability to deliver BBs into the airsoft gun’s chamber for firing without jams, misfeeds, or other interruptions. This aspect is paramount, as failures in feeding reliability directly impede the airsoft gun’s functionality and reduce the player’s effectiveness during gameplay. The visual styling of the “zombie hunter” theme becomes irrelevant if the magazine cannot perform its core function.
- Spring Tension and BB Advancement
The spring within the magazine is responsible for applying consistent pressure to the BB stack, pushing them upwards towards the feeding port. Insufficient spring tension results in weak or inconsistent BB advancement, leading to misfeeds. Conversely, excessive tension can cause BBs to bind within the magazine. Examples of this include new magazines requiring a “break-in” period or older magazines experiencing spring fatigue. The proper balance of spring tension is crucial for reliable feeding.
- Follower Design and Material
The follower is the component that directly contacts the BB stack, guiding them towards the feeding port. Its design and material influence its ability to smoothly advance the BBs without snagging or binding. A poorly designed follower can tilt or jam, disrupting the BB flow. Materials such as low-friction polymers are often used to minimize resistance. A follower that is warped or damaged will impair the magazine’s feeding reliability.
- Magazine Lip Integrity
The magazine lips are the upper edges of the magazine that retain the BBs until they are stripped by the airsoft gun’s mechanism. Damaged, bent, or worn magazine lips can release BBs prematurely or fail to properly present them for feeding. The lips must maintain precise dimensions and alignment to ensure consistent BB presentation. Metal magazine lips are generally more durable than plastic, but are still susceptible to damage from impacts or mishandling.
- BB Quality and Compatibility
The quality and type of BBs used directly impact feeding reliability. Low-quality BBs may have inconsistent dimensions or surface imperfections that cause them to jam within the magazine or airsoft gun. Using BBs that are too large or too small for the magazine’s design will also lead to feeding problems. Using high-quality, appropriately sized BBs is essential for maintaining consistent feeding reliability.

Frequently Asked Questions
This section addresses common queries and misconceptions regarding airsoft gun magazines marketed with a “zombie hunter” theme. The information provided aims to offer clarity and guidance for prospective purchasers and users.
Question 1: Are “zombie hunter” airsoft gun magazines functionally different from standard magazines?
The core functionality of a “zombie hunter” airsoft gun magazine remains the same as a standard magazine: to reliably feed BBs into the airsoft gun. The primary difference lies in the aesthetic styling, which often includes thematic graphics, finishes, or accessories. Internal mechanisms are typically identical to those found in standard magazines of comparable capacity and compatibility.
Question 2: Does the “zombie hunter” theme affect magazine durability?
The “zombie hunter” theme itself does not directly impact magazine durability. Durability is primarily determined by the materials used in construction (e.g., polymer, metal), the manufacturing process, and the design of internal components. A “zombie hunter” magazine constructed from high-quality materials will be as durable as a standard magazine made with the same materials. Conversely, a poorly constructed “zombie hunter” magazine will be as fragile as a similarly made standard magazine.
Question 3: Are “zombie hunter” magazines compatible with all airsoft guns?
Compatibility is dictated by the magazine’s design and its intended airsoft gun platform. A “zombie hunter” magazine designed for an M4-style airsoft gun will only be compatible with M4-style airsoft guns that adhere to standard magazine well dimensions. Compatibility must be verified based on the specific airsoft gun model and the magazine’s published specifications, regardless of the thematic styling.
Question 4: Do “zombie hunter” magazines offer any performance advantages?
The “zombie hunter” theme provides no inherent performance advantages. The performance of an airsoft gun magazine is determined by factors such as its capacity, feeding reliability, and construction quality, not by its aesthetic design. High-capacity “zombie hunter” magazines may offer a sustained rate of fire, but this is a function of their capacity, not the theme itself.
Question 5: Are “zombie hunter” magazines more expensive than standard magazines?
Pricing is influenced by several factors, including the manufacturer, materials used, capacity, and complexity of the aesthetic design. “Zombie hunter” magazines may be priced higher than standard magazines of comparable specifications due to the added cost of the thematic styling. However, price variations also exist within the standard magazine market, based on brand reputation and features.
Question 6: Are there any legal restrictions on owning or using “zombie hunter” airsoft gun magazines?
Legal restrictions governing airsoft gun magazines typically pertain to capacity limitations or restrictions on transporting replica firearms in public spaces. These regulations apply equally to “zombie hunter” and standard airsoft gun magazines. It is the responsibility of the user to be aware of and comply with all applicable local, regional, and national laws regarding airsoft guns and accessories.
